Initiating action refers to the process of starting a task or project by taking the first steps needed to move forward. It involves making decisions, setting goals, and mobilizing resources to begin execution. This concept is crucial in various contexts, such as personal development, leadership, and project management, as it transforms ideas into tangible outcomes. Ultimately, initiating action is about overcoming inertia and making progress toward objectives.

What does it mean to file a lawsuit and what are the steps involved in initiating legal action?

Filing a lawsuit means starting a legal process to resolve a dispute in court. The steps involved in initiating legal action typically include: 1) Filing a complaint outlining the claims, 2) Serving the complaint to the defendant, 3) The defendant responding to the complaint, 4) Discovery phase where evidence is gathered, 5) Pre-trial motions, 6) Trial, and 7) Judgment.


What is the party initiating legal action in a criminal case known as?

The party initiating legal action in a criminal case is known as the prosecution. This typically involves the government or state, represented by a prosecutor, who brings charges against an individual or entity accused of committing a crime. The prosecutor's role is to present evidence and argue the case in court to seek a conviction.

Name of party initiating a legal action against another?

The party initiating a legal action against another is called the "plaintiff" in civil cases, while in criminal cases, the party is referred to as the "prosecutor." The plaintiff seeks to obtain a legal remedy, such as damages or an injunction, while the prosecutor represents the government in pursuing charges against a defendant accused of a crime.


What is an example of an initiating event in a story?

Any action or idea that sets the rising action into motion is an initiating event. Some examples include Harry Potter's mysterious letter, Luke Skywalker's new android running away, and Bilbo Baggins vanishing from his birthday party.
